Bakehouse Art Complex’s Studio Residency program offers affordable studio spaces to professional emerging and mid-career artists of local, national or international origin.

The residency program also provides artists with 24/7 access to their studio and shared facility spaces, professional development opportunities, and internal artist programming, among other amenities. Networking and professional development opportunities include Open Studio events, exhibition receptions, and organized studio visits with recognized art professionals, internal programming opportunities and artist invitationals, and access to a dedicated staff that regularly communicates with all artists.

The Studio Residency Program offers 62 indoor and outdoor studios at below-market prices starting at $22.00/ft² on our 2.3 acre campus, including water, light, and additional amenities. Studio rents range from $305/month - $1315/month. Additional subsidy will be considered for artists who demonstrate financial need.

Bakehouse Art Complex’s Associate Artist Program is an artist membership program offering professional local artists 24/7 access to our shared art-making facilities and professional development opportunities, internal artist programming, and public networking opportunities.

Networking and professional development opportunities include Open Studio events, exhibition receptions, and organized studio visits with recognized art professionals, internal programming opportunities and artist invitationals, and access to a dedicated staff that regularly communicates with all artists.

Ideal candidates are: talented emerging and mid-career artists who are committed to their art practice; artists who seek to actively contribute and engage with a collaborative peer community of over one hundred working professionals;
artists who do not need a dedicated studio space are encouraged to apply.

The Associate Artist Program costs $550 per year.

Shared Artist Facilities include:

- A Woodshop with a table saw, band saw, drill press, dust vaccum,
belt sander and work benches;

- CNC Facility with a Shopbot 4x8 CNC machine and software;

- A Print-Making Facility with three printing presses, drying racks,
glass tables for ink mixing, resin box for aquatint, and fumes extractor.

- Darkroom with 9 enlargers to make silver gelatin prints in a range of formats from 35mm to 8x10”; trays, tongs, a paper water filter, a sink,
drying racks, a shared fridge, and locker space

- Ceramics facility with throwing wheels, a glaze room,
and a kiln room with electric and manual kilns, a gas kiln for soda,
and reduction firings, a front-loading electric high-fire kiln,
and a small test electric kiln.

- A Metal-work facility with a MIG welder, TIG welder, Torch,
Fuel/air tanks, Grinders, a Sander, a Pneumatic air tank, a Chop saw,
a Band saw, and Vacuum/fans

- a Digital Print Lab with an Epson P1000 Archival Ink Printer,
and an Epson V850 Scanner, and various papers included.
